British Ministry of Defence Closes Down the UK UFO Desk -  the UK MOD made
an almost casual but rather striking announcement it has closed down its UFO desk
as of December 1, 2009.  Significantly, the MOD indicated it would continue to
release more government UFO files.   The full statement can be read at:
http://tinyurl.com/btezh3

This stance may seem paradoxical, but PRG sees a straightforward logic to this
maneuver.   First and foremost it reflects the fact that the United Kingdom, above all
other nations, is most tied to U.S. policies on all levels.  This is reinforced under the
leadership of Gordon Brown, but may attenuate should David Cameron become
prime minister.  Only time will tell how well the people of the UK are served by this
tethering.

That said, closing down the MOD UFO Desk sends the message the UK will not act
ahead of the United States as regards Disclosure.

However, the continued release of UK UFO files will keep pressure on the U.S. to act
on Disclosure.
